Horatio Nelson, 1st Viscount Nelson vs. William Ewart Gladstone

Vice Admiral Horatio Nelson, 1st Viscount Nelson, 1st Duke of Bronté, (29 September 1758 – 21 October 1805) was a British flag officer in the Royal Navy. William Ewart Gladstone, (29 December 1809 – 19 May 1898) was a British statesman of the Liberal Party.
